What Defines History Under Social Science

This category is distinct from popular history in several key ways:

Analytical Approach

Focuses on cause-and-effect relationships, structural forces, and long-term societal patterns.

Interdisciplinary Perspective

Draws from sociology, political science, economics, and anthropology to interpret historical developments.

Institutional Focus

Examines governments, markets, religious institutions, social movements, and cultural systems.

Evidence-Based Scholarship

Relies on primary sources, academic research, and theoretical frameworks to support arguments.

Rather than retelling events, these books explain the broader systems that shaped them.

FAQ

How is this different from general history books?

General history collections often focus on narrative storytelling or specific eras. Social science history emphasizes analytical frameworks, institutional development, and systemic interpretation.

Are these books academic?

Many titles are grounded in scholarly research, but they are often written in accessible language suitable for informed general readers.

Do these books focus on specific regions?

The collection includes global perspectives, covering multiple regions and civilizations through comparative analysis.

Are these books suitable for university study?

Yes. Many titles in this category are commonly referenced in social science and history courses.

Do these books include biographies?

Biographies may appear when relevant, but the primary focus is on structural forces, institutions, and societal transformation rather than individual life stories.
